C文件高效备份与快速还原技巧
c文件备份还原

首页 2025-05-22 02:04:27



C文件备份与还原:确保数据安全与业务连续性的关键实践 在当今数字化时代,数据已成为企业最宝贵的资产之一

    无论是源代码、配置文件还是业务数据,C文件(泛指以.c为扩展名的C语言源代码文件及其他关键配置文件)作为软件开发和系统运维的核心组成部分,其完整性和安全性直接关系到企业的运营效率和竞争力

    因此,实施有效的C文件备份与还原策略,不仅是预防数据丢失、损坏的防线,更是保障业务连续性和数据安全性的关键举措

    本文将深入探讨C文件备份与还原的重要性、实施方法、最佳实践以及面临的挑战与解决方案,旨在为企业提供一套全面而实用的指导框架

     一、C文件备份与还原的重要性 1. 数据安全的首要防线 在软件开发过程中,C文件包含了程序逻辑、算法实现、接口定义等核心信息

    一旦这些文件因意外删除、硬件故障或恶意攻击而丢失,将直接导致项目进度受阻,甚至可能引发知识产权泄露的风险

    定期备份C文件,确保在遭遇不测时能快速恢复,是维护数据安全的第一道防线

     2. 保障业务连续性 对于依赖特定软件或系统运行的业务而言,C文件的完整性和可用性直接关系到服务的稳定性和连续性

    例如,金融交易系统、医疗信息系统等关键领域,任何数据中断都可能导致巨大的经济损失或社会影响

    通过实施高效的备份与还原机制,可以在最短时间内恢复服务,最大限度减少业务中断的影响

     3. 支持版本控制与协作 在团队开发环境中,C文件的频繁修改和版本迭代是常态

    有效的备份机制不仅有助于记录文件的历史版本,便于追踪变更和回溯问题,还能支持多成员间的协同工作,确保团队成员可以基于正确的版本进行开发,减少合并冲突和错误引入

     二、C文件备份的实施方法 1. 本地备份 - 手动备份:最基础的方式,通过复制粘贴或使用命令行工具将C文件复制到外部存储设备(如U盘、移动硬盘)或网络共享文件夹中

    虽然简单,但易出错且难以保证备份的及时性和完整性

     - 自动化脚本:编写或利用现有的脚本工具,设定定时任务自动将C文件备份到指定位置

    这种方法提高了备份的效率和可靠性,但仍受限于单一物理位置的脆弱性

     2. 远程备份 - 云存储:利用AWS S3、阿里云OSS等云服务提供商的存储服务,将C文件上传到云端

    云备份不仅提供了更高的数据冗余度和可用性,还支持跨地域的数据复制,增强了数据的安全性

     - 版本控制系统:如Git、SVN等,不仅实现了文件的版本管理,还提供了分支、合并等高级功能,非常适合团队协作开发场景

    通过将C文件纳入版本控制系统,可以确保每次修改都被记录,便于回溯和协作

     3. 混合备份策略 结合本地备份和远程备份的优势,实施多层次的备份策略

    例如,定期将C文件备份到本地服务器的同时,也将其同步至云存储,实现数据的双重保护

    此外,还可以考虑设置异地容灾备份,进一步增强数据恢复的能力

     三、C文件还原的最佳实践 1. 定期测试备份恢复流程 确保备份数据的有效性和可恢复性至关重要

    企业应定期(如每季度)进行备份恢复演练,验证备份数据的完整性和恢复流程的顺畅性,及时发现并修正潜在问题

     2. 建立快速响应机制 一旦发生数据丢失或损坏事件,应立即启动应急响应计划,快速定位并恢复最近的备份数据

    建立明确的责任分工和沟通机制,确保团队成员在紧急情况下能够迅速行动,减少恢复时间

     3. 保持备份环境的更新 随着技术的不断进步,备份软件和硬件也在不断迭代

    企业应定期评估现有备份解决方案的性能和安全性,适时升级至最新版本,确保备份环境的稳定性和兼容性

     4. 文档化与培训 制定详细的备份与还原操作手册,包括备份策略、恢复步骤、常见问题及解决方案等,确保所有相关人员都能理解和执行备份操作

    同时,定期举办培训活动,提升团队的数据保护意识和技能

     四、面临的挑战与解决方案 1. 存储空间限制 随着C文件数量和大小的增加,备份所需的存储空间也在不断增长

    解决方案包括采用压缩技术减少备份数据大小、实施数据去重策略以及根据文件重要性设定不同的备份周期和保留策略

     2. 备份窗口紧张 在业务高峰期进行备份可能会影响系统性能

    通过优化备份策略(如增量备份、差异备份)、调整备份时间窗口(如利用业务低峰期)以及采用高效备份技术(如并行处理、多线程)可以有效缓解这一问题

     3. 数据安全性 备份数据本身也可能成为攻击目标

    加强备份数据的加密存储、访问控制以及传输安全,是保护备份数据不被非法访问和篡改的关键

     4. 合规性要求 不同行业对数据保护和备份有特定的合规要求(如GDPR、HIPAA)

    企业应确保备份策略符合相关法律法规要求,定期审查备份流程和文档,以应对可能的合规审计

     结语 C文件备份与还原不仅是技术层面的操作,更是企业数据治理和风险管理的重要组成部分

    通过实施科学合理的备份策略、采用先进的备份技术和工具、建立健全的应急响应机制,企业可以有效防范数据丢失风险,保障业务连续性和数据安全,为企业的稳健发展提供坚实支撑

    在数字化转型加速的今天,让我们携手并进,共同守护数据这一企业最宝贵的财富

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道